A bail bondsman in Hartford serves as a lifeline for individuals who find themselves entangled in the legal system, often at a moments notice. When someone is arrested, the court typically sets a bail amount, which acts as a financial guarantee that the defendant will return for their court appearances. However, the sum can be prohibitively high, leaving many unable to afford it. This is where the bail bondsman steps in, providing an essential service that allows defendants to be released from custody while awaiting trial.

The process begins when a defendant or their family contacts a bail bondsman for assistance. The bondsman assesses the situation, considering factors such as the nature of the alleged crime, the defendants history, and their ties to the community. Once the bail bondsman agrees to take on the case, they post a bond with the court, typically for a fee that represents a percentage of the total bail amount. This fee is non-refundable but is a small price for the freedom and peace of mind it buys.

Despite the important role they play, bail bondsmen sometimes face criticism. Some argue that the system disproportionately affects those who are economically disadvantaged, as they may struggle to afford even the percentage fee required by bondsmen. The debate over bail reform continues, with some advocating for a system that does not rely on financial means to determine a person's freedom. Nonetheless, until such reforms are widely enacted, bail bondsmen remain a necessary component of the judicial system.
